Parents, teachers, and crafty people are always looking for ways to recycle and find new uses for household items. Egg cartons, for example, can be reused in many ways. By making a large caterpillar from an egg carton you can both eliminate trash and entertain children. Read on to learn more. Using your scissors, cut the egg carton in half, lengthwise down the middle. You should end up with two equally long halves which will be the caterpillar’s body. Notice that the inner side on each half has ridges cut into the bottom. Recreate these ridges on the opposite side of the caterpillar’s body. Cut pieces of pipe cleaner numbering the amount of legs you want on each caterpillar that are long enough to go through one side of the caterpillar’s body and out the other. These will become the legs. Using caution, poke a hole in each side of the caterpillar where you want the legs to go. Insert the pieces of pipe cleaner in one side and out the other.
